linux下撤销命令是哪个

fiy 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ux下,撤销命令的主要是通过使用Ctrl+Z来实现。当你在执行一个命令时,如果想要中断这个命令,可以按下Ctrl+Z键。这将会暂停当前正在执行的命令,并将其放入后台(即将其进程挂起)。此时,你可以通过使用`bg`命令将进程转移到后台继续执行,或者使用`fg`命令将进程转移到前台继续执行。

    另外,如果你在执行一个长时间运行的命令时,你可以使用Ctrl+C键来立即终止该命令。当你按下Ctrl+C键时,系统会发送一个中断信号(SIGINT)给正在运行的命令,这将导致命令立即退出。

    此外,还有一种撤销命令的方式是使用`kill`命令。通过`ps`命令找到要终止的命令的进程号(PID),然后使用`kill`命令发送一个终止信号给该进程,即可终止该命令的执行。

    总之,在Linux下,撤销命令的方式有多种,你可以根据具体的情况选择合适的方式来撤销正在执行的命令。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ux下撤销命令的主要方式是使用`history`命令和`ctrl+r`快捷键。

    1. `history`命令:`history`命令会显示当前用户在终端中输入的所有命令历史记录。可以使用`history`命令来查看历史命令的编号,然后使用`!编号`来重新执行该命令,或者使用`!字符串`来重新执行包含该字符串的最近一条命令。例如,输入`history`会显示最近使用的命令列表,然后输入`!35`会重新执行第35条命令。

    2. `ctrl+r`快捷键:当用户在终端中输入命令时,按下`ctrl+r`快捷键可以打开一个交互式的搜索功能,用于查找之前执行过的命令。只需按下`ctrl+r`后开始输入要查找的命令的部分或关键字,终端会自动显示匹配的历史命令。可以使用`ctrl+r`连续按下多次来查找匹配的下一个命令,然后按下`Enter`键来执行该命令。

    除了以上方法外,还有其他一些撤销命令的方式:

    3. `reset`命令:`reset`命令在终端窗口中清除屏幕内容,并将光标移动到屏幕的左上角。这可以撤销所有之前在终端中输出的内容,相当于重新打开一个新的终端窗口。

    4. `Ctrl+c`快捷键:`ctrl+c`快捷键可以用来中断当前正在执行的命令。这是一种迅速撤销命令的方式,适用于需要中止长时间运行的命令。

    5. `history -c`命令:`history -c`命令可以清除当前用户的命令历史记录。执行该命令后,之前输入的所有命令都会被删除,从而撤销之前的所有命令。

    总结起来,在Linux下撤销命令的方式包括使用`history`命令和`ctrl+r`快捷键来重新执行之前的命令,使用`reset`命令来清除屏幕内容,使用`ctrl+c`快捷键来中断正在执行的命令,以及使用`history -c`命令来清除命令历史记录。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ux下,可以使用`Ctrl + Z`键组合来撤销(暂停)正在运行的命令。当你按下`Ctrl + Z`后,正在执行的命令将被暂停,并将返回到命令行界面。

    撤销命令是一种非常有用的功能,当你意识到正在运行的命令有误或者不需要继续执行时,可以立即停止。可以使用撤销命令来避免执行不必要的操作或者在执行复杂的命令时对其进行调试。

    以下是在Linux下使用撤销命令的方法和操作流程。

    1. 运行一个长时间执行的命令,例如:`sleep 10`,它将使系统等待10秒钟。
    2. 此时,命令正在执行。你可以看到命令的输出或者在终端窗口中看到光标闪烁,表明正在运行命令。
    3. 按下`Ctrl + Z`键组合。命令将会被暂停,并在终端窗口显示一个编号,例如:`[1]+ Stopped sleep 10`。这意味着命令已经被暂停,而且可以稍后继续运行。
    4. 你可以使用`jobs`命令来查看当前正在后台运行的作业。例如:`jobs`。
    5. 使用`fg`命令将命令移到前台继续运行。例如:`fg %1`,其中`%1`是`[1]+`中的编号。
    6. 如果你想彻底撤销命令而不是继续运行,可以使用`kill`命令来中止。例如:`kill %1`。

    以上就是在Linux下撤销命令的方法和操作流程。使用撤销命令可以更加高效地管理和控制正在运行的命令,帮助你在系统维护和日常操作中更加灵活和快捷。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部